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What types of stone are used for driveways? Common options include granite, limestone, and flagstone, each offering different textures and appearances for driveways.
How durable are stone driveways? Stone driveways are highly durable and can withstand heavy vehicle traffic with minimal maintenance over time.
Are stone dri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, stone driveways perform well in various climates, including areas with freeze-thaw cycles, when properly installed.
What is involved in installing a stone driveway? Installation typically includes preparing the base, laying the stones, and ensuring proper drainage and compaction for stability.
